Key ceremony checklist — item 4 (CharsetProbe)

For future maintainers: CharsetProbe handles encoding detection for uploaded text files on the Ferrowell intake pipeline. At this step, confirm the detection model's signing key was rotated and the old key shredded. Verify two witnesses initialed the log. If the signing vault refuses the new key, unlock it with the recovery passphrase recorded just below this item.

unlock words, hahip-baduf: holwyn-istath-julvan

Ticket: DEDUP-412 — Connection failures during customer record dedup

The Larkspur dedup job started failing overnight with pool exhaustion errors. It merges duplicate customer records in batches of 500, but the batch worker isn't releasing connections after a merge conflict, so the pool drains within twenty minutes. Proposed fix: wrap merges in a try/finally release and cap retries at three. For the sync, reproduce against staging using the connection string below.

primary connection of bagep-kaweg = clickhouse://rusdor_svc:3TXlgH7O8DuUYI@db-ae3f.zarqelgrid.internal:5432/zordor

Ticket #4182 — ChipGate reader firmware rejected at Lakemoor Marathon staging. Hey, welcome aboard! The signature check on the StrideSync timing-chip reader fails because the old cert expired last week. Nothing's wrong with your build. Just re-sign the firmware bundle before flashing. Use the current release key, which is the following:

rollout seal: bky4_x7Gc

So you want your plugin to survive dark mode in the Mothbeam admin dashboard — good instinct. Don't hardcode hex values; pull from the theme tokens we expose, or your panel will glow like a flashlight at 2am. Test both palettes with the toggle in the dev toolbar, and check focus rings especially, since those get lost easily. Report rendering bugs against the dashboard build you tested, which is the identifier printed directly below.

pipeline stamp: htk9_ce63042d9

**Q: Why do the Pendrake Pay integration tests flake?**

Most flakes trace to the sandbox ledger resetting mid-run. Before approving a retry-heavy PR, confirm the author pinned the ledger snapshot and disabled parallel settlement fixtures. If the sandbox account itself locks out after repeated failures, restore access using the recovery passphrase below.

unlock words, yawig-kagef: gordor-holvan-ulaael-pramir-ulaiel-tamdor